"Harlem Residents Demand Answers as Cooling Tower Lawsuits Mount: A growing cluster of mysterious illnesses in the Harlem neighborhood of New York City has been linked to two city-owned sites, sparking outrage and calls for accountability. Lawsuits filed by affected residents claim that improperly maintained cooling towers at these sites released toxic bacteria, putting scores of people at risk of serious health problems. As the investigation unfolds, community leaders are demanding that city officials take responsibility for the alleged neglect and provide immediate relief to those affected by the outbreak.
